The biohazard symbol is used in the labeling of biological materials that carry a significant health risk, including viral and bacteriological samples, including infected dressings and used hypodermic needles (see sharps waste). The biohazard symbol was developed by the Dow Chemical Company in 1966 for their containment products. Web(b) Separate the categories of medical waste at the point of origin into appropriate containers that are labeled as required under subdivision (c). (c) Label the containers required under subdivision (b) with a biohazard symbol or the words “medical waste” or “pathological waste” in letters not less than 1 inch high.
